Browse Source

2025-10-16

采购标签生成查询优化
master
fengyuan_yang 3 months ago
parent
commit
74ce420ffb
  1. 1
      src/main/java/com/gaotao/modules/wms/data/InboundQcResultData.java
  2. 6
      src/main/resources/mapper/wms/WmsPrintMapper.xml

1
src/main/java/com/gaotao/modules/wms/data/InboundQcResultData.java

@ -42,4 +42,5 @@ public class InboundQcResultData extends QueryPage {
@DateTimeFormat(pattern = "yyyy-MM-dd")
@JsonFormat(pattern = "yyyy-MM-dd", timezone = "GMT+8")
private Date endDate;
private String notifyNo;
}

6
src/main/resources/mapper/wms/WmsPrintMapper.xml

@ -7,6 +7,7 @@
SELECT
a.site,
a.bu_no,
A.order_no AS notifyNo,
d.inspection_no AS order_no,
a.order_status,
d.part_no,
@ -36,7 +37,10 @@
and A.bu_no=#{query.buNo,jdbcType=CHAR}
</if>
<if test="query.orderNo != null and query.orderNo != ''">
and A.order_no like '%'+ #{query.orderNo,jdbcType=CHAR} +'%'
and d.inspection_no like '%'+ #{query.orderNo} +'%'
</if>
<if test="query.notifyNo != null and query.notifyNo != ''">
and a.order_no like '%'+ #{query.notifyNo} +'%'
</if>
<if test="query.partNo != null and query.partNo != ''">
and b.part_no like '%'+ #{query.partNo,jdbcType=CHAR} +'%'

Loading…
Cancel
Save